"Unveiling Forest City: Malaysia's Enigmatic Chinese-Constructed Metropolis"

Forest City, a Chinese-built mega-project in Malaysia, was intended to house one million people but currently only has a 1% occupancy rate. The isolated location, high prices, and lack of amenities have deterred potential tenants, earning it the nickname "Ghost City." The project's developer, Country Garden, faces significant debts and the challenges of China's property market crisis. Factors such as visa restrictions, political instability, and Covid-related travel restrictions have further hampered the project. The fate of Forest City and similar projects depends on the Chinese government's support, but the current situation highlights the gap between ambition and reality in China's property market.

"The Ghost City: California's Third Largest Metropolis Remains an Empty Maze of Roads"

Eerie photographs reveal the remains of California City, a planned metropolis that was intended to be the third-largest city in California but never came to fruition. The city, located in the Mojave Desert, was designed in the late 1950s with hopes of attracting 400,000 residents, but today it is home to only 15,000 people. The vast network of roads and named streets remain largely barren, with few houses or businesses developed. The failed project raises questions about the sustainability of building a water-rich city in the desert. "Farmers Revive Abandoned Chinese Ghost Town, Transforming Mansions"

A luxury complex in Shenyang, China, known as the State Guest Mansions, has been reclaimed by local farmers after being abandoned by property giant Greenland Group. The development, which was planned as European-style villas, stands as a symbol of the excesses and corruption in China's housing market. The reasons for the project's failure remain unclear, but suspicions of official corruption have been raised. Ghost towns like this one now dot urban landscapes across China, as the government's crackdown on excessive borrowing and speculation has left several developers burdened with debt and facing flagging demand. Urban explorers are showing interest in these ghost towns, documenting their findings online.

Mystery buyer acquires California ghost town for $22.5M

A mystery buyer, Ecology Mountain Holdings, has purchased the property and mining claims of Eagle Mountain, a former iron-mining town in California, for roughly $22.5 million. The town served as a bustling company town for Kaiser Steel Mine until its closure in the 1980s. The buyer's plans for the vast property remain unclear. Eagle Mountain has remained uninhabited but not necessarily abandoned, and has served as a backdrop for Hollywood movies and music videos.

The Future of Music Streaming: Fortnite

Fortnite has transformed from a straightforward multiplayer battle royale to a unique multimedia experience, with pop music having an audible presence in the game for years. Epic Games has taken its music licensing to an entirely new dimension, positioning Fortnite not just as a virtual billboard for promoting pop artists, but as its own kind of full-service streaming platform. The expansion of music licensing in Fortnite shows just how deeply embedded multiplayer gaming has become in pop culture, as the battle royale transforms from a straight-forward game concept to a massive streaming portal for media of all stripes.
